Is the Canon Vixia HG20 compatible with iMovie .08?

Can I use a card reader to transfer videos?

Thanks, but I did not phrase the question properly. I have iMovie '08 on all my computers, and am stuck with a Sony tape video cam with no Firewire extension--only USB. Thus, I cannot transfer my tape data to my Macintosh G5. Having spent a week fighting with this and looking for help from Apple and Sony, I have reached the conclusion that a new camcorder that doesn't depend on wire transmission but uses a card is the way to go. However, from reading other forums it seems that even the card readers sometimes have problems with connecting to Macs and iMovie. Canon seems to be the most Macintosh friendly, but not always.
